Job Description

Responsibility:
  • Strategic Management:

  • Oversee the strategic planning and execution of alliance agreements.
  • Ensure alignment of alliance goals with Takeda's strategic objectives.
  • Identify and mitigate risks associated with alliances.
  • Operational Oversight:

  • Manage day-to-day operations of alliance agreements.
  • Monitor the progress of collaborations and ensure milestones are met.
  • Coordinate with internal teams to support alliance activities.
  • Communication & Collaboration:

  • Maintain effective communication channels with external partners.
  • Foster a collaborative environment to ensure mutual benefit.
  • Facilitate regular meetings and updates between Takeda and its partners.
  • Performance Management:

  • Track and report on the performance of alliance agreements.
  • Conduct regular reviews and assessments of partnerships.
  • Implement corrective actions when necessary to address issues or enhance performance
  • Capability Enhancement

  • Develop and implement strategies to enhance Takeda’s alliance management capabilities.
  • Stay updated on industry trends and best practices in alliance management.
  • Provide training and support to internal teams on alliance management practices

Qualification: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ences, Business, or a related field.
  • Advanced degree (MBA, MS, PhD) preferred
  • Proven experience in alliance management within the pharmaceutical or biotech industry.
  • Strong communication and negotiation skills and the ability to build and maintain relationships with external partners and internal stakeholders.
  • Excellent organizational and project management skills.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Familiarity with the pharmaceutical industry’s regulatory environment.
  • Ability to travel as required to meet with partners and stakeholders.
